Kl. Dixon et Fa. Duck, DETERMINING THE CONDITIONS FOR MEASUREMENT OF SPATIAL-PEAK TEMPORAL-AVERAGED INTENSITY IN SCANNED ULTRASOUND BEAMS, British journal of radiology, 71(849), 1998, pp. 968-971
This paper describes a new three stage approach which simplifies the p
rocess of measurement of spatial-peak temporal-averaged intensity for
scanned ultrasound beams. Firstly, the conditions delivering the maxim
um total acoustic power are determined. Secondly, out-of-plane beamwid
ths are measured which, together with knowledge of the in-plane scan w
idths, are used to locate the depth at which the scanned area is at a
minimum. Finally, the spatial-peak temporal-average intensity is measu
red using the conditions and depth identified in the first two stages.
Experimental results justify the use of this new procedure.
